检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
机构地区:[1]上海交通大学安泰管理学院,上海200052 [2]复旦大学计算机与信息技术系,上海200433
出 处:《计算机研究与发展》2006年第2期295-300,共6页Journal of Computer Research and Development
基 金:国家自然科学基金重点项目(69933010);国家自然科学基金项目(70172011)~~
摘 要:在高质量的无线通信网络中,带宽不稳定和用户移动性成为影响移动事务处理的主要因素,导致事务冲突率上升、吞吐量下降和峰值情况复杂等结果·一种新的并发控制方法ASGT能够:①具有比2PL更小的阻塞面和更高的并发度;②预先发现非串行化调度,有效降低阻塞率,缩短阻塞时间·ASGT结合MWDL方法能够提高系统性能,降低调度代价·理论分析和模拟实验证明了ASGT方法的性能·Mobile transaction management is one of the most important fields in the research of mobile database. Though disconnection will never be a main problem in the high quality of wireless network nowadays, the high instability of bandwidth still produces a larger fluctuation of transaction executing time which leads to a higher blocking rate. Furthermore, due to high density of MUs, the database server will work under a high workload circumstance and meet the thrashing in a larger probability. A new scheme, called ASGT (active serialization graph technique), is developed to overcome these problems. In the ASGT, reading never blocks writing, thus it can substantially reduce the blocking rate. The ASGT can detect and break some non-serializable scheduling in advance, which can greatly shorten the suspending time of transactions involved. Due to an explicit serializable sequence maintained in running time, the scheduler, integrating an aborting method called MWDL, can improve the throughput and reduce the scheduling cost. The theoretical analysis and execution of a simulation based on C ++ SIM show that the performance of the ASGT overmatches an improved 2PL in most conditions of a mobile environment.
分 类 号:TP311.13[自动化与计算机技术—计算机软件与理论]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.188